Hamilton police say remains of two people have been found at different locations in city. 

This is the third finding of bodies and remains to be found this week in Hamilton.

On Tuesday police announced they had found the body of a Hamilton teen who went missing in October of last year.

Police say on Wednesday at 3:30 p.m. a dead male was discovered off the rail trail near the Chedoke stairs.

According to police, the male has been identified and police are trying to locate the family.

Police say the cause of death hasn't been determined, but police don't suspect foul play.

Hamilton police also announced Thursday that they're investigating after human remains were discovered near the shore in the area of Millen Road in Stoney Creek.

Police say the initial remains were found Tuesday and more discovered on Wednesday. 

It isn't known whether the remains belong to a male or female. 

Police say they are currently conducting a ground search of the area.

At this point, police say foul play isn't suspected.
